AlphaGo, a computer system program developed by DeepMind, plays the famous Lee Sedol, winner of 18 world titles, famed for his creativity and extensively thought about to be among the biggest players of the previous decade. During the games, AlphaGo played a number of inventive winning moves. In game 2, it played Move 37 - a creative relocation helped AlphaGo win the video game and overthrew centuries of traditional knowledge.

Developed by scientists at DeepMind, WaveNet is a new deep neural network for producing raw audio waveforms allowing it to model natural sounding speech. WaveNet was used to model many of the voices of the Google Assistant and other Google services.

In a paper released in the Journal of the American Medical Association, Google shows that a machine-learning driven system for diagnosing diabetic retinopathy from a retinal image might perform on-par with board-certified ophthalmologists.
Google launches "Attention Is All You Need," a term paper that presents the Transformer, a novel neural network architecture particularly well fit for language understanding, amongst lots of other things.
Introduced DeepVariant, an open-source genomic alternative caller that significantly enhances the accuracy of determining alternative places. This development in Genomics has added to the fastest ever human genome sequencing, and helped produce the world's first human pangenome referral.

DeepMind's AlphaFold is acknowledged as a solution to the 50-year "protein-folding issue." AlphaFold can accurately forecast 3D designs of protein structures and is accelerating research in biology. This work went on to get a Nobel Prize in Chemistry in 2024.

NeuralGCM, a new maker learning-based technique to imitating Earth's environment, is presented. Developed in partnership with the European Centre for Medium-Range Weather Forecasts (ECMWF), NeuralGCM combines conventional physics-based modeling with ML for improved simulation accuracy and efficiency.
Our combined AlphaProof and AlphaGeometry 2 systems fixed 4 out of six problems from the 2024 International Mathematical Olympiad (IMO), attaining the very same level as a silver medalist in the competition for the very first time.
